    Ambience-wise, Parmigiano was good and quiet. The place was also big and has a loft area for more seats. For the food, they had a wide selection of pastas, pizzas, appetizers, and so on. We ordered the 6 cheese pizza and the frutti de mare (tomato). They came with complimentary bread pre-meal. The pizza was good and you could really taste the many cheese that topped it. What I really enjoyed however was the pasta (frutti de mare), it had a very seafood and flavorful taste. There was also a generous serving of the prawns and mussels on our plate. I highly recommend the dish. Overall, although the place could be a bit more expensive than other italian restaurants, it is still a worthy place to go to once in a while.

    Went to dinner one night. All our orders were ok except for the fettuccini ai funghi. As you can see the fettuccini is broken up, its "durog". As you can probably imagine pasta isn't supposed to be like that. I have a feeling it was sitting pre mixed with the sauce for some time under a heater lamp or just stuck in the ref together then heated upon order. Ordered other dishes which were fine but when a pasta at an italian restaurant comes in small mushy, pieces instead of long and chewy, you know you have less than sub par restaurant. So I wont even get into reviewing the other dishes, the pasta was just the show stopper- in the worst way possible.
